The Wild is Always There was received with acclaim and pleasure on publication. It is the first collection of its kind, an astonishing anthology of writing about Canada by some of the world's most renowned writers, including Charles Dickens, Arthur Conan Doyle, Elizabeth Bishop, William Faulkner, Ernest Hemingway, Mark Twain, Willa Cather, Jules Verne, Graham Greene and many more. This remarkable array of short stories, travel essays, poems, plays, comedy, suspense and adventure spans three centuries of writing. The Wild is Always There cannot fail to make any reader admire and be amazed by this country.

Greg Gatenby, the artistic Director of the Harbourfront Reading Series, is a poet and the author of Whales: A Celebration. He lives in Toronto.
